在线观看 国产-在线高清一级欧美精品-在线高清国产-在线福利视频-久久观看视频-久久观看

下載吧 - 綠色安全的游戲和軟件下載中心

軟件下載吧

當(dāng)前位置:軟件下載吧 > 數(shù)據(jù)庫(kù) > DB2 > MongoDB副本集認(rèn)證機(jī)制:加強(qiáng)安全保護(hù)(mongodb副本集認(rèn)證)

MongoDB副本集認(rèn)證機(jī)制:加強(qiáng)安全保護(hù)(mongodb副本集認(rèn)證)

時(shí)間:2024-03-26 14:34作者:下載吧人氣:35

MongoDB副本集認(rèn)證機(jī)制是一種認(rèn)證技術(shù),可以保證數(shù)據(jù)庫(kù)服務(wù)器在多個(gè)節(jié)點(diǎn)中共享資源時(shí),每個(gè)節(jié)點(diǎn)的安全性。MongoDB副本集認(rèn)證機(jī)制通過(guò)關(guān)鍵密鑰分布機(jī)制和對(duì)每個(gè)客戶端訪問(wèn)的驗(yàn)證,來(lái)保護(hù)系統(tǒng)安全和數(shù)據(jù)完整性。

MongoDB副本集認(rèn)證機(jī)制的客戶端認(rèn)證和服務(wù)器認(rèn)證是保護(hù)系統(tǒng)安全的基礎(chǔ)。客戶端認(rèn)證采用MongoDB認(rèn)證機(jī)制,每個(gè)客戶端都必須使用有效的憑據(jù)才能訪問(wèn)到MongoDB副本集。而服務(wù)器認(rèn)證則是通過(guò)在每臺(tái)MongoDB實(shí)例間同步維護(hù)的復(fù)制密鑰的過(guò)程來(lái)驗(yàn)證這些節(jié)點(diǎn)是否可以訪問(wèn)數(shù)據(jù)庫(kù)。為了啟用服務(wù)器認(rèn)證機(jī)制,需要在MongoDB配置文件中配置 security.keyFile 參數(shù)。

MongoDB副本集認(rèn)證的關(guān)鍵步驟如下:

1. 在MongoDB副本集中生成管理密鑰;

2. 將管理密鑰分發(fā)給所有節(jié)點(diǎn);

3. 在每個(gè)MongoDB實(shí)例上激活認(rèn)證機(jī)制;

4. 設(shè)置客戶端憑據(jù)和訪問(wèn)權(quán)限;

5. 啟用服務(wù)器認(rèn)證機(jī)制。

下面我們來(lái)實(shí)際代碼,以下是使用MongoDB副本集認(rèn)證機(jī)制的例子:

的建立管理密鑰:

“`

mkdir /var/opt/keyfiles

openssl rand -base64 756 > /var/opt/keyfiles/mongo-keyfile

chmod 600 /var/opt/keyfiles/mongo-keyfile

chown mongod:mongod /var/opt/keyfiles/mongo-keyfile

“`

在MongoDB配置文件中配置 security.keyFile 參數(shù):

“`

# Replica set configuration

security:

keyFile: /var/opt/keyfiles/mongo-keyfile

“`

客戶端連接時(shí)提供憑據(jù):

import pymongo
username = 'xxx'
password = 'xxx'
client = pymongo.MongoClient(
'mongodb://{}:{}@localhost:27019/test'.format(username, password))

最后,啟用MongoDB副本集認(rèn)證機(jī)制:

rs.initiate(
{
_id : 'replica_set_name',
version: 1,
members: [
{ _id : 0, host : 'mongo1:27017' },
{ _id : 1, host : 'mongo2:27017' },
{ _id : 2, host : 'mongo3:27017' }
]
})

以上展示了MongoDB副本集認(rèn)證機(jī)制的完整步驟,這一機(jī)制是MongoDB社區(qū)專門(mén)為保護(hù)數(shù)據(jù)安全和完整性而研發(fā)的,可以確保多臺(tái)節(jié)點(diǎn)之間的數(shù)據(jù)安全。使用MongoDB副本集認(rèn)證機(jī)制,可以有效加強(qiáng)系統(tǒng)安全,保護(hù)數(shù)據(jù)不被輕易的竊取或被惡意攻擊。

標(biāo)簽mongodb副本集認(rèn)證,MongoDB,MongoDB,認(rèn)證,機(jī)制,副本,客戶端,安全

相關(guān)下載

查看所有評(píng)論+

網(wǎng)友評(píng)論

網(wǎng)友
您的評(píng)論需要經(jīng)過(guò)審核才能顯示

熱門(mén)閱覽

最新排行

公眾號(hào)

主站蜘蛛池模板: 性欧美另类老妇高清 | 精品久久综合一区二区 | 日本午夜高清视频 | 亚洲无线码一区二区三区 | 国色天香社区在线观看免费播放 | 亚洲婷婷综合色高清在线 | 亚洲四虎 | 亚洲成人免费电影 | 中文字幕在线精品视频入口一区 | 男女男精品视频在线播放 | 中文字幕亚洲第一 | 国产免费一级在线观看 | 亚洲成人伊人网 | 亚洲天堂成人在线观看 | 久久国产热视频 | 国产成人精品久久二区二区 | 亚洲福利电影一区二区? | 亚洲精品乱码久久久久久蜜桃欧美 | 久久国产综合精品欧美 | 国产性一交一乱一伦一色一情 | 国产精品第一区在线观看 | 国产亚洲一级精品久久 | 最新中文字幕一区二区乱码 | 中文字幕国产在线 | 波多野结衣免费线在线 | 99热这里只有精品一区二区三区 | 羞羞视频免费网站 | 性插网站 | 99热只有精品一区二区 | 波多野结衣视频免费 | 亚洲免费网站 | 在线观看网址入口2020国产 | 亚洲欧美精品一中文字幕 | 羞羞网站在线播放 | 久久99九九99九九99精品 | 日韩视频第一页 | 精品久久久久久免费影院 | 国产精品高清视亚洲乱码 | 日韩视频网 | 亚洲最大私人电影院入口 | 亚洲第一页中文字幕 |